Key differences between Calabrio One and ZIWO

  • Pricing: ZIWO starts at $109 /User/Month. Calabrio One pricing is not publicly listed.
  • Free trial: ZIWO offers a free trial; Calabrio One does not.
  • Target audience: Calabrio One is built for Medium Business and Small Business, while ZIWO targets Large Enterprises and Medium Business.
  • User satisfaction: ZIWO scores higher with a 4.7-star average.
  • Deployment: Calabrio One supports SaaS/Web/Cloud, Installed - Windows; ZIWO supports SaaS/Web/Cloud, Installed - Windows, Installed - Mac.

ZIWO

Cloud contact center solution excelling in CRM integration and call tracking.

Choose if
  • You need seamless integration with multiple CRMs for call logging and analytics.
  • Your team values advanced IVR and automated phone number country code detection.
  • You want a user-friendly interface with strong call tracking and recording features.
Consider alternatives if
  • Your company requires highly stable voice quality without occasional disruptions.
  • You depend on extensive call analytics like call counting on home page and call number search.

Nextiva

Best for SMBs needing reliable, easy-to-use cloud call center with multi-channel support.

Choose if
  • You want a simple, streamlined setup with fast issue resolution.
  • Your team relies on integrated voice, video, chat, and social media communication.
  • You prioritize reliable call quality with minimal dropped calls or audio issues.
Consider alternatives if
  • Your company requires highly customized or complex call center workflows.
  • You need extensive on-premises telephony infrastructure rather than cloud-based solutions.
